Recognizing Protection Approaches
Comprehending the different protection methods your attorney may use is vital to efficiently navigating your case. Each strategy depends upon the specifics of the fees you're dealing with and the proof versus you. First off, if there's a lack of evidence, your lawyer might say that the prosecution hasn't satisfied its burden of proof. Remember, it's not your job to confirm virtue; it's the prosecutor's job to show regret past an affordable doubt. If they can't, you need to be acquitted.
One more typical strategy is self-defense, specifically in cases entailing fees like attack or murder. If you were shielding yourself, your lawyer might use this method to justify your actions legitimately. This requires proving that your assumption of threat was reasonable and that your response was in proportion to that risk.
In some cases, your defense could involve wondering about the legality of just how proof was obtained. If law enforcement breached your rights during the examination, evidence may be reduced, which can considerably damage the prosecution's instance.
Lastly, your lawyer might negotiate a plea bargain if it serves your best interest. This generally occurs if the proof against you is strong but there are minimizing aspects that can cause decreased fees or sentencing.
Recognizing these methods aids you discuss your instance better with your legal representative.
